Types of Welding Qualifications
Although the American Welding Society’s regular CW certificate helps make you eligible for the majority of positions, many fields demand a specific certification. A handful of the most-popular of these appear below.
- API Certification for individuals that work on pipelines in the oil and gas field
- ASME Certification for those who handle boiler and pressurized containers
- SCWI and CWI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
- CW Certification to be a Certified Welder

Welding Programs – Some Things You Can Expect
The following suggestions should certainly help assist you in deciding which certified welding schools will be the ideal match for you. Selecting welding training may possibly sound very simple, however you must ensure that you’re deciding on the right type of training. welder school or program you end up picking should also be certified by the AWS. Some other areas which you may want to look at besides the accreditation status include:
- Confirm the college’s curriculum provides you with courses in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
- Find colleges that comply with AWS SENSE standards
- See if the program gives financial support
- Be sure the college trains with machinery that satisfies the latest trade specifications
